protagonist in French

protagonist in French is protagoniste, héros, héroïne — protagonist means the main character in a story, film, or play.

What does "protagonist" mean?

  1. noun The main character in a story, film, or play.
    "The protagonist must choose between loyalty and ambition."
  2. noun A leading figure or champion of a cause.
    "She became a leading protagonist of the reform movement."
